#1d9fd2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d9fd2 is composed of 11.4% red, 62.4%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.2% cyan, 24.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 196.9 degrees, a saturation of 75.7% and a lightness of 46.9%. #1d9fd2 color hex could be obtained by blending #3affff with #003fa5. Closest websafe color is: #3399cc.

Shades and Tints of #1d9fd2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000203 is the darkest color, while #f1fafd is the lightest one.
